I would prepare as many new pots as you perceive plants, with a depression in the middle. Then I would set up a container of water and place the plants in that container. Then I would gently separate them in the water and place each plant in their respective new pot. Then I would top water each pot so that the soil media fills in the gaps. I have also done things like cover the pots and keep out of direct light for a couple days, so as to minimize shock. I did that with new plants received in the mail.
